Discuz!中的附件设置
不可能解决。5d6d限制的附件大小就是512K。这需要你能够修改phpini,这显然是不可能的,只有5d6d开发/管理团队才办得到。 这种设置关系到服务器方面,不是在5d6d提供给你的discuz后台可以办得到的。
所有的5d6d论坛都是共用一个phpini的,修改了你的岂不是影响其他人的了。
上传大小限制和两个地方相关,一个是在 用户组》基本设置》附件相关
一个就是服务器限制上传的大小
你要先到后台首页 看看你的服务器上传许可是多大才行,
比如我的是20M,也就是说我上传最大是20M
如果要该这个限制的话 要改服务器配置文件,楼主可以找空间商 让他改一下就行
至于楼主说的phpini那个是PHP的配置文件 是在服务器上的 并不是dz里的
可以登录phpmyadmin
进入附件表:表前缀_forum_attachment
如图查看:
如果是在模板中获取aid可用以下方式:
$aid = DB::result_first("SELECT aid FROM %t WHERE tid=%d",array('forum_attachment',$v['tid']));注意:$v['tid'] 换成对应的tid变量
在模板中执行的话这段代码要放在
<!--{eval 上面的代码 }-->中
首先要检查附件是否成功上传。检查方法,到附件文件夹对应路径查看。如果确定文件已经成功上传,需要检查已上传文件大小是否和本地大小相同,如相同,仍不显示,可以下载已上传文件到本地测试是否可以正常打开。
0条评论